INTRODUCTION
The Specialist Diploma in Interior & Landscape Design (SDILD) is structured to equip you with the knowledge of principles and theories in interior and landscape design, and how they are applied in real life. From idea conception to planning and creating spaces, you will explore new technologies to improve your design solutions and gain critical knowledge of building and material science to understand the behavioral, social and physical requirements of design in the built environment. Upon graduation, you could look forward to a career as technical specialists in the interior and landscape design industry.

ENTRY REQUIREMENT
Applicants who do not wish to complete the Specialist Diploma programme are not subject to the entry requirements. The applicant must be a Singapore Citizen or Permanent Resident or holder of valid employment pass/work permit; and possess one of the following qualifications in a relevant discipline:
a) A diploma (min course duration of 2 years) or equivalent qualification
b) A relevant Advanced Certificate / Higher NITEC / Advanced NBQ with 2 to 3 years of relevant work experience
c) A relevant certificate with 4 to 5 years of relevant work experience
d) NITEC / Higher NBQ with at least 5 years of relevant work experience requirements will be reviewed on a case-by-case basis.
Note: Applicants with relevant working experience but do not fulfil the above requirements will be reviewed on a case-by-case basis.
Applicants must have their own computers/laptops with minimum specifications to run BIM software and access student portal.
Applicant with degree or diploma qualification where English is not the medium of instruction is required to achieve the ESS Workplace Literacy Test Level 6 issued by SkillsFuture Singapore (SSG).

AWARD OF CERTIFICATE
A participant must attain at least 75% of physical attendance and complete all assignments to acceptable standards to be eligible to be awarded each modular certificate. Participant who did not complete the assignments to acceptable standards but attained at least 75% of physical attendance will be issued with a certificate of attendance. The successful achievement of all modular certificates will lead to the awarding of the Specialist Diploma in Interior & Landscape Design (SDILD).
